Ranch Dressing and Dip Mix
![](images/side5b.jpg)
This versatile ranch dressing mix converts easily into a creamy dip or smooth salad dressing. It's delicious served with fresh veggies or drizzled over greens. And pared with a few different vegetables, it makes a great side dish and a break from lettuce salads.
Prep time:
Ingredients:
2 tablespoons plus 2 teaspoons dried minced onions
1 tablespoon dried parsley flakes
2 1/2 teaspoons paprika
2 teaspoons sugar
2 teaspoons salt
2 teaspoons pepper
1 1/2 teaspoons 1-1/2 garlic powder
ADDITIONAL INGREDIENTS FOR DRESSING:
1 cup mayonnaise
1 cup buttermilk
ADDITIONAL INGREDIENTS FOR DIP:
1 cup sour cream
Directions:
In a small bowl, combine the first seven ingredients. Store in an airtight container in a cool, dry place for up to 1 year. Yield: about 6 tablespoons mix (enough to make 6 batches).
To prepare dressing: In a bowl, combine 1 tablespoon mix with mayonnaise and buttermilk; refrigerate. Yield: 2 cups.
To prepare dip: In a bowl, combine 1 tablespoon mix and sour cream; refrigerate for at least 1 hour before serving.
